diff mbox

i386: Add missing include file for QEMU_PACKED

Message ID 1391205924-28586-1-git-send-email-sw@weilnetz.de
State Accepted
Headers show

Commit Message

Stefan Weil Jan. 31, 2014, 10:05 p.m. UTC
Instead of packing BiosLinkerLoaderEntry, an unused global variable called
QEMU_PACKED was created (detected by smatch static code analysis).

Including qemu-common.h gets the right definition and also includes some
standard include files which now can be removed here.

Cc: qemu-stable@nongnu.org
Signed-off-by: Stefan Weil <sw@weilnetz.de>
---
 hw/i386/bios-linker-loader.c |    3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

Comments

Michael Tokarev Feb. 1, 2014, 9:43 a.m. UTC | #1
01.02.2014 02:05, Stefan Weil wrote:
> Instead of packing BiosLinkerLoaderEntry, an unused global variable called
> QEMU_PACKED was created (detected by smatch static code analysis).
> 
> Including qemu-common.h gets the right definition and also includes some
> standard include files which now can be removed here.

A good one.

Thanks, applied to the trivial patches queue.

/mjt
diff mbox

Patch

diff --git a/hw/i386/bios-linker-loader.c b/hw/i386/bios-linker-loader.c
index fd23611..aa56184 100644
--- a/hw/i386/bios-linker-loader.c
+++ b/hw/i386/bios-linker-loader.c
@@ -18,11 +18,10 @@ 
  * with this program; if not, see <http://www.gnu.org/licenses/>.
  */
 
+#include "qemu-common.h"
 #include "bios-linker-loader.h"
 #include "hw/nvram/fw_cfg.h"
 
-#include <string.h>
-#include <assert.h>
 #include "qemu/bswap.h"
 
 #define BIOS_LINKER_LOADER_FILESZ FW_CFG_MAX_FILE_PATH